what是一個了不起的庫,它可以創(chuàng)建出漂亮的頁面效果

2023-12-01    分類: 網(wǎng)站建設(shè)

什么

這是一個了不起的庫,它可以用幾行代碼創(chuàng)建漂亮的頁面效果。就網(wǎng)站而言,這使它變得更加有趣。

如果你這樣想:“孩子,我需要另一個圖書館,就像我需要腦袋一樣”,那么加入這個俱樂部。這正是我第一次遇到它時的想法。

我使用過 Moo.fx、TW-SACK 和。參與過RICO、YUI等庫的開發(fā)。

不,我不再接近了。但是我仍然盡量保持頭腦清醒,并嘗試?yán)^續(xù)使用 AJAX 進(jìn)行思考。

所以當(dāng)我見面時,我想:“我還需要另一個圖書館嗎?不需要,謝謝……”

為什么

為什么我會改變我的看法,為什么你應(yīng)該考慮使用它?很簡單,只要看看你使用的頁面,就會發(fā)現(xiàn)它是如此的簡單易用。只使用了幾行。可以表現(xiàn)出非常優(yōu)雅的效果。有一天突然看到寫的一些代碼,頓時豁然開朗。早茶的時候,例行的查看訂閱,去看每日必看的內(nèi)容,在設(shè)計博客的時候,看到了一個寫好的例子。原來這些代碼還是有一些瀏覽器相關(guān)的bug,但是這些概念還是我以前從未見過的。

還有那些代碼...

代碼看起來很簡單,看起來不像我以前見過的,但也不是沒有道理。

我開始通讀文檔,驚訝地發(fā)現(xiàn)用一點代碼可以完成這么多事情。

什么時候

你應(yīng)該在需要的時候使用它。

給你一個小的庫文件DOM強(qiáng)大的控制能力不費(fèi)吹灰之力的工作,一點點的努力。

或者

快速通過AJAX,無需大量無用代碼和一些基本的動畫效果

如果你需要超級花哨的效果、動畫、拖放和超級流暢的動畫,那么你可能想要使用它。它是一個擁有大量動畫效果的庫。

你可以從官網(wǎng)下載他的源代碼(10K)。

WHO

是約翰。

.() 是一個在傳統(tǒng)中吃苦耐勞的家伙。長期以來,它一直被程序員用作解決客戶端頁面加載問題的捷徑。

但有時等待頁面加載速度不夠快。

只有少數(shù)大圖片文件會被快速加載,而大多數(shù)大圖片文件會使 .() 加載非常緩慢。因此,當(dāng)我為最近的網(wǎng)絡(luò)營銷創(chuàng)建 Web 應(yīng)用程序時php獲取服務(wù)器ie版本,我不得不希望它會更快。.() 周圍的一些新研究(例如蛋糕)代碼是一種快速方法。有需要的可以試試。

但是如果你想做一些DOM(文檔對象模型)編程,那你何不試試呢,就像自己做蛋糕,嘗一嘗一樣。(雙關(guān)蛋糕,詼諧的話)。

有一個方便的小函數(shù)用作快速 DOM 加載,即......它在頁面加載之前執(zhí)行。

$(document).ready(function(){
// Your code here...
});

您可以使用它來加載您想要加載的任何編碼樣式,不一定要保留。也可以同時執(zhí)行多個功能。

你之前可能見過類似 init() 的函數(shù),你會發(fā)現(xiàn)它要快得多。

我們將在以后的教程中一遍又一遍地使用這個函數(shù)。

好的,你現(xiàn)在可以試試代碼了:(記得把它引用到你的頁面中。如果你不記得,請閱讀上一篇。)

$(document).ready(function(){
alert("Congratluations!");
});

很容易,不是嗎?幾分鐘內(nèi)制作的雙色表。

本節(jié)本身沒有多大價值,重點是它提供的示例。重要的部分我會貼出代碼和評論:先看看傳統(tǒng)的做法:預(yù)覽地址(可以查看源碼)。我們來看看如何用5行代碼來做:





Stripingtable





?

姓名 年齡 QQ Email
鄧國梁 23 31540205 gl.deng@gmail.com
鄧國梁 23 31540205 gl.deng@gmail.com
鄧國梁 23 31540205 gl.deng@gmail.com
鄧國梁 23 31540205 gl.deng@gmail.com
鄧國梁 23 31540205 gl.deng@gmail.com
鄧國梁 23 31540205 gl.deng@gmail.com

pS: 飄飄說我的table沒有,我知錯了...

預(yù)覽地址

這里有一個技巧我不得不提:什么是連鎖經(jīng)營?我們看一下,應(yīng)該是這樣寫的:

$(".stripe tr").mouseover(function(){
$(this).addClass("over");})
$(".stripe tr").mouseout(function(){
$(this).removeClass("over"); })

但我們寫道:

$(".stripe tr").mouseover(function(){
$(this).addClass("over");}).mouseout(function(){
$(this).removeClass("over");})

因為鼠標(biāo)移入和移出都發(fā)生在同一個對象上,所以我們可以將發(fā)生在同一個對象上的動作寫在一起。這樣,如果對象很多,并且發(fā)生了很多動作,就會節(jié)省很多錢。代碼。(我暫時是這么理解的,不知道是否還望高人指正。)

*

15 Days of (Day 3)---一個巧妙的偽裝鏈接

今天的教程是倉促完成的。想在15天前放一些東西,簡單說一下php獲取服務(wù)器ie版本,免得一些js新手被一堆代碼搞糊涂了。事實上,我快要結(jié)束了。這個決定是當(dāng)時做出的。

目標(biāo)

我們將使用創(chuàng)建一小段代碼來轉(zhuǎn)換和偽裝頁面上的所有超鏈接。

部分加盟經(jīng)銷商認(rèn)為,部分用戶有足夠的洞察力去發(fā)現(xiàn)加盟鏈接,可以盡量避免點擊網(wǎng)址鏈接直接進(jìn)入瀏覽器,從而“欺騙”加盟經(jīng)銷商離開代理(假設(shè)已經(jīng)發(fā)生購買)

“舊”方法

有許多附屬分銷商千方百計隱藏他們的鏈接,以防止人們通過鏈接找到他們。這些技巧涉及。和服務(wù)器端代碼。但是對于本教程,我將重點放在“老派”上:

該代碼用于在瀏覽器狀態(tài)欄中顯示用戶鼠標(biāo)指向的鏈接地址。比如實際鏈接是,可以在狀態(tài)欄顯示

問題

您是一個非?;钴S的子分銷商,您可能會以瘋狂的速度添加指向許多頁面的鏈接。而且你必須在每個鏈接上添加這個效果,那么你肯定會感到無聊。加入有一天你要修改任務(wù)欄 估計顯示鏈接的時候你會抓狂的。

解決方案

首先,我們想盡快偽裝我們的鏈接,所以我們應(yīng)該從這里開始:


當(dāng) DOM 準(zhǔn)備好時,我們放入其中的代碼開始執(zhí)行。

下一個

在所有我們要偽裝的鏈接上加一個,這樣可以幫助我們找到需要偽裝的鏈接,留下其他不需要偽裝的鏈接。有兩個作用: 當(dāng)鼠標(biāo)移到鏈接上時,會出現(xiàn)一個小框形狀 提示顯示網(wǎng)址: 并且在瀏覽器的狀態(tài)欄中顯示相同的信息(僅限IE)。

"http://www.affsite.com?id=123" title="http://www.affsite.com" class="affLink">Super Duper product

告訴查找?guī)в?= "" 的鏈接

$('a.affLink')

添加鼠標(biāo)懸停事件

$('a.affLink').mouseover(function(){window.status=this.title;return true;})

簡單的說:查找所有帶有=“”的鏈接,將鼠標(biāo)懸停在瀏覽器狀態(tài)欄信息上時,將其更改為鏈接的內(nèi)容。這不能正常工作,但只能在 IE 中工作。It 中的狀態(tài)欄僅顯示“完成”,或者更準(zhǔn)確地說,將鼠標(biāo)懸停在超鏈接上對狀態(tài)欄沒有影響。我沒有更多的瀏覽器測試。

繼續(xù)——讓我們使用“鏈?zhǔn)健狈椒?,像這樣:

$('a.affLink').mouseover(function(){window.status=this.title;return true;})
.mouseout(function(){window.status='Done';return true;});

這段代碼告訴你改變?yōu)g覽器的狀態(tài)欄信息,或者當(dāng)鼠標(biāo)不在鏈接上時返回“完成”。如果你不習(xí)慣鏈的工作方式,那么你可以這樣寫:

$('a.affLink').mouseover(function(){window.status=this.title;return true;});
$('a.affLink').mouseout(function(){window.status='Done';return true;});

由你決定。

把這些代碼放在一起:


最后的想法。有的人可能覺得今天的課程太簡單了,有的人可能還有點不清楚,因為你們不是二級經(jīng)銷商。

在接下來的“日子”中,你會看到我得到更多,并與你或不。

該規(guī)則提到了如何防止垃圾郵件:不要將您的電子郵件地址放在任何一個:鏈接中。在與垃圾郵件作斗爭的過程中,我們的網(wǎng)頁設(shè)計師和程序員總結(jié)了一些創(chuàng)造性的解決方案。讓我們快速看看這些常用方法的一些缺點(或多或少)。

名稱 [無垃圾郵件]

問題:鏈接類型更方便,在收件人字段中輸入電子郵件地址可能會出錯。

當(dāng)前文章:what是一個了不起的庫,它可以創(chuàng)建出漂亮的頁面效果
本文地址:http://www.muchs.cn/news41/297991.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站維護(hù)Google、商城網(wǎng)站自適應(yīng)網(wǎng)站、品牌網(wǎng)站設(shè)計、企業(yè)建站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

小程序開發(fā)